PURPOSE OF THE UNIT STANDARD 
This unit standard is intended:
  • To provide conceptual knowledge of the areas covered
  • For those working in, or entering the workplace in the area of Information Technology
  • As additional knowledge for those wanting to understand the areas covered

    People credited with this unit standard are able to:
  • Describe professionalism for the computer industry in South Africa
  • Describe the codes of practice for professionalism in the IT industry in South Africa
  • Describe the code of ethics in the computer industry in South Africa
    The performance of all elements is to a standard that allows for further learning in this area. 

  • LEARNING ASSUMED TO BE IN PLACE AND RECOGNITION OF PRIOR LEARNING 
    The credit value of this unit is based on a person having prior knowledge and skills to:
  • Describe the management and use of computers in organisations

    Specific Outcomes and Assessment Criteria: 

    SPECIFIC OUTCOME 1 
    Describe professionalism for the computer industry in South Africa. 

    ASSESSMENT CRITERIA
     

    ASSESSMENT CRITERION 1 
    1. The description identifies acceptable and unacceptable professional practices found in the computer industry. 

    ASSESSMENT CRITERION 2 
    2. The description identifies known professional bodies in South Africa. 
    ASSESSMENT CRITERION RANGE 
    Includes but is not limited to: CSSA; BITF; ITUC; ITA (at least 2)
     

    ASSESSMENT CRITERION 3 
    3. A short description of each named professional body is provided. 
    ASSESSMENT CRITERION RANGE 
    As for criteria 1.2
     

    SPECIFIC OUTCOME 2 
    Describe the codes of practice for professionalism in the IT industry in South Africa. 

    ASSESSMENT CRITERIA
     

    ASSESSMENT CRITERION 1 
    1. The description identifies the codes of practice for the IT industry in South Africa. 

    ASSESSMENT CRITERION 2 
    2. The description provides a brief explanation of the codes of practice identified. 

    SPECIFIC OUTCOME 3 
    Describe the code of ethics in the computer industry in South Africa. 

    ASSESSMENT CRITERIA
     

    ASSESSMENT CRITERION 1 
    1. The description confirms that the computer industry supports equality of opportunity. 

    ASSESSMENT CRITERION 2 
    2. The description confirms the understanding that the computer industry is against computer software piracy. 

    ASSESSMENT CRITERION 3 
    3. The description identifies ways in which piracy is addressed in South Africa.

    UNIT STANDARD ESSENTIAL EMBEDDED KNOWLEDGE 
    1. Performance of all elements is to be carried out in accordance with organisation standards and procedures, unless otherwise stated. Organisation standards and procedures may cover: quality assurance, documentation, security, communication, health and safety, and personal behaviour. An example of the standards expected is the standards found in ISO 9000 Certified Organisations.

    2. Performance of all elements complies with the laws of South Africa, especially with regard to copyright, privacy, health and safety, and consumer rights.

    3. All activities must comply with any policies, procedures and requirements of the organisations involved, the ethical codes of relevant professional bodies and any relevant legislative and/ or regulatory requirements.
